This micro-credential introduces core concepts of social cohesion and inclusion within African Higher Education Institutions. Drawing on global frameworks and institutional best practices, the course supports participants to critically reflect on inclusion within their own universities and to explore practical strategies for building more equitable, accessible and socially responsive learning environments.
Through pre-recorded input, selected readings, a live case study from the UNINA–SINAPSi Centre, group activities and a structured final reflection, participants will gain theoretical insights and applied tools to strengthen inclusive practice across their institutions.
By the end of this micro-credential, participants will be able to:
Define key concepts of social cohesion, exclusion, segregation, integration and inclusion in higher education.
Identify global frameworks and institutional responsibilities related to inclusive practice.
Critically reflect on the current state of inclusion within their own HEIs.
Analyse the SINAPSi Centre as an institutional example of inclusive student support and anti-discriminatory practice.
Design a small evidence-informed inclusion action plan or self-assessment tool for their own HEI.
Contribute to a structured evaluation of inclusion initiatives and suggest context-specific improvements.
